History: Guy Niv finished the Tour de France Israel today

For a small country, with a desert, a lake and a sea, a historic sporting cornerstone was added today (Sunday), one that great and modest powers have long since recorded - an Israeli rider in an Israeli team who successfully completed the Tour de France, the world's most difficult and prestigious professional road bike race.

Israel Startup Nation and Guy Niv crossed the last section of the column tonight and fulfilled a dream for thousands of riders who sat in their homes in Israel, in closure, and saw how an industry that barely existed here five years ago is slowly becoming part of the world top. 

3,484.2 km, 21 sections, tackling hail, side wind, endless hikes in the Alps, 30 riders falling on the road, moments of crisis, some Israeli flags on the side of the road and a clear goal - to finish the column successfully and if possible, enjoy the road. 

Niv made it as big.

With slender shoulders, even stronger legs and mentality that allowed him to get through all the bumps that awaited him along the way.

Anyone who abandoned his first Giro d'Italia in 2018 due to illness, was forced to remain in quarantine in Israel because of the corona and trained in the north of the country as if it were the Pyrenees, proved that the task is not big for him. 

Niv crosses the gate of victory, today // Photo: Noa Arnon 

True, Niv was not close to winning a section in the column and was far from excelling in one of them (tonight he entered an escape group for the first and last time in the column), but he proved his place there.

The place of Israelis in the prestigious platoon in the world. 

From now on, after the owners of the Sun Sylvan Adams and Ronny Brown (who did not take off their smiles for a moment today in the team's special tent at the finish line) were the ones who put Israel on the bike map, hopefully this is the opening shot for a national model that will make young riders realize Themselves the Cole de la Madeleine.

The last section was won by Sam Bennett from the Deconic Quick Step team (2: 53.32 hours) and proved that it is not for nothing that he also wears the green shirt of the column - the champion of scores and sprints.

Niv finished the last stage in 100th place and in the overall ranking he is ranked 139 out of 146 riders who survived the column.

"I was shivering"

"I went through difficult moments, which forced me to dig as deep as I could - but for a moment I had no doubt - I will come to Paris," said Niv, "now - at the finish line on the Champs Elysees I can finally breathe a sigh of relief. We did it. I'm happy."

At the end of the column he said: "I had to feel these moments. I experienced them as a spectator when I stood there, a 13-year-old boy who received a dream gift for a bar mitzvah. Now I pass the same boulevard as the first Israeli rider. I shivered even though I was used to it for the past three weeks. All this is of course a huge personal satisfaction but even more so - the belief that it will bring about change for the bicycle industry in Israel. Maybe there is now one child who saw me and the group today - and now it will be his dream. If enough children dream and want - many will follow and come To this summit and they will even move me in their achievements. "
